报表工具如何与订单管理系统集成,实现订单数据自动化报告?

报表工具
报表系统
报表软件
预计阅读时长:5 min

在当今数字化转型的浪潮中,企业对数据的依赖程度越来越高。为了提升业务效率,很多企业希望将报表工具与订单管理系统集成,实现订单数据的自动化报告。本文将详细探讨如何通过集成报表工具与订单管理系统,实现订单数据的自动化报告,从而帮助企业更高效地处理数据,做出快速、准确的业务决策。

报表工具如何与订单管理系统集成,实现订单数据自动化报告?

一、报表工具与订单管理系统的集成概述

报表工具与订单管理系统的集成,旨在将订单管理系统中的数据自动导入报表工具,生成实时的订单报告。这一过程不仅能够节省大量的人力成本,还能确保数据的准确性和及时性。集成的主要步骤包括数据源配置、数据传输机制的建立、报表模板的设计以及自动化调度的设置。

1. 数据源配置

数据源配置是集成的第一步。报表工具需要能够访问订单管理系统的数据库或API接口。常见的数据源包括关系型数据库(如MySQL、SQL Server)、NoSQL数据库(如MongoDB)以及Web API。配置数据源时,需要确保报表工具具备相应的数据访问权限,并能够正确解析数据结构。

2. 数据传输机制的建立

为了实现数据的自动传输,需要建立数据传输机制。可以采用定时任务或事件驱动的方式,将订单管理系统中的数据定期或实时地推送到报表工具。定时任务适用于数据变化不频繁的场景,而事件驱动适用于需要实时响应的场景。

3. 报表模板的设计

报表模板的设计是集成过程中至关重要的一环。报表工具需要提供强大的设计功能,支持用户通过拖拽操作轻松创建复杂的报表。模板设计应考虑数据的展示形式、筛选条件以及交互功能,确保最终生成的报表能够满足业务需求。

4. 自动化调度的设置

为了实现自动化报告,需要设置报表工具的自动化调度功能。通过设定定时任务或触发条件,报表工具可以在指定时间或事件发生时自动生成并发送报告。这样,企业管理者可以随时获取最新的订单数据,进行及时的业务分析和决策。

二、数据源配置的关键步骤

数据源配置是实现报表工具与订单管理系统集成的基础。下面是配置数据源的关键步骤:

1. 确定数据源类型

首先,确定订单管理系统所使用的数据源类型。常见的数据源类型包括关系型数据库、NoSQL数据库以及Web API。不同的数据源类型需要不同的配置方式。FineReport支持多种数据源类型,能够满足企业的多样化需求。

2. 获取数据访问权限

确保报表工具具备访问订单管理系统数据源的权限。通常需要数据库管理员或系统管理员提供相应的访问凭证(如用户名和密码)。对于API接口,需要获取API密钥或令牌。

3. 配置数据连接

在报表工具中配置数据连接。以FineReport为例,可以通过数据连接管理界面,添加新的数据源,输入相应的连接信息(如数据库地址、端口、用户名和密码),并测试连接是否成功。

4. 验证数据访问

配置完成后,验证数据访问是否正常。在报表工具中执行简单的查询,确保能够正确获取订单管理系统中的数据。如果存在数据访问问题,需要检查连接配置和权限设置。

三、数据传输机制的建立

数据传输机制是实现订单数据自动化报告的关键。以下是建立数据传输机制的主要步骤:

1. 选择合适的数据传输方式

根据订单管理系统的数据变化频率和报告需求,选择合适的数据传输方式。常见的数据传输方式包括定时任务和事件驱动。

  • 定时任务:适用于数据变化不频繁的场景。可以设定固定的时间间隔(如每天、每小时)定期传输数据。
  • 事件驱动:适用于需要实时响应的场景。通过监听订单管理系统中的数据变更事件,实时推送数据到报表工具。

2. 实现数据传输逻辑

根据选择的数据传输方式,编写相应的数据传输逻辑。对于定时任务,可以使用调度工具(如Cron)定期触发数据传输脚本。对于事件驱动,可以使用消息队列或Webhook机制,实时推送数据。

3. 处理数据传输中的异常情况

在数据传输过程中,可能会遇到网络中断、权限问题等异常情况。需要设计相应的错误处理机制,确保数据传输的稳定性和可靠性。例如,可以设置重试机制,在数据传输失败时自动重试。

4. 确保数据传输的安全性

数据传输过程中,确保数据的安全性至关重要。可以采用加密传输、身份验证等安全措施,防止数据泄露和篡改。

四、报表模板的设计与自动化调度

报表模板的设计和自动化调度是实现订单数据自动化报告的核心。以下是设计报表模板和设置自动化调度的主要步骤:

1. 确定报表需求

首先,确定报表的需求。包括报表的展示形式、数据筛选条件、交互功能等。根据不同的业务场景,设计不同类型的报表,如订单明细报表、订单汇总报表、订单趋势分析报表等。

2. 设计报表模板

在报表工具中设计报表模板。以FineReport为例,可以通过简单的拖拽操作,轻松创建复杂的报表。模板设计应考虑数据展示的美观性和易读性,同时确保报表能够满足业务需求。

3. 配置报表数据源

在报表模板中配置数据源。选择已经配置好的订单管理系统数据源,编写相应的数据查询语句,确保报表能够正确获取订单数据。

4. 设置自动化调度

设置报表工具的自动化调度功能。通过设定定时任务或触发条件,自动生成并发送报告。FineReport支持多种调度方式,可以根据业务需求灵活配置。

五、实现订单数据自动化报告的效果与价值

通过集成报表工具与订单管理系统,实现订单数据自动化报告,不仅能够提升业务效率,还能为企业带来诸多价值:

1. 提高数据处理效率

自动化数据传输和报告生成,减少了人工操作,提升了数据处理效率。企业管理者可以更及时地获取最新的订单数据,快速做出业务决策。

2. 确保数据的准确性和一致性

自动化数据传输避免了人工录入的错误,确保了数据的准确性和一致性。企业可以依靠准确的数据进行分析和决策,提升业务的准确性。

3. 提升业务透明度

通过自动化报告,企业可以实时监控订单数据,提升业务透明度。管理者可以随时查看订单的详细情况,及时发现和解决问题。

4. 优化资源配置

自动化报告减少了人力资源的投入,企业可以将更多的人力资源投入到其他核心业务中,提升整体业务效益。

综上所述,通过集成报表工具与订单管理系统,实现订单数据自动化报告,能够显著提升企业的数据处理效率和业务决策能力。如果您希望进一步了解如何实现订单数据自动化报告,建议您试用FineReport这一强大的企业级报表工具。

FineReport免费下载试用

总而言之,报表工具与订单管理系统的集成,能够显著提升企业的数据处理效率和业务决策能力。通过数据源配置、数据传输机制的建立、报表模板的设计以及自动化调度的设置,企业可以实现订单数据的自动化报告,提升业务透明度和资源配置效率。如果您希望进一步了解如何实现订单数据自动化报告,FineReport作为一款功能强大的企业级报表工具,将是您的理想选择。立即下载安装试用,体验其带来的高效与便捷。

本文相关FAQs

报表工具如何与订单管理系统集成,实现订单数据自动化报告?

问题1:报表工具与订单管理系统集成的主要步骤有哪些?

报表工具与订单管理系统的集成是一个复杂的过程,需要多个步骤的无缝配合。以下是主要步骤:

  1. 需求分析:首先,需要确定集成的主要目标和需求。明确需要生成哪些类型的报表、数据源、数据更新的频率等。
  2. 系统评估:评估现有订单管理系统的架构和数据结构,确保报表工具能够兼容并集成。
  3. 选择合适的报表工具:推荐使用帆软的FineReport,因其强大的集成能力和灵活性,可以通过点击链接下载试用: FineReport免费下载试用
  4. 数据接口设计:设计并实现数据接口,确保订单管理系统的数据可以实时或定期地导入报表工具。常见的数据接口包括API、数据库连接(如JDBC、ODBC)等。
  5. 数据清洗与转换:集成过程中,需要对导入的数据进行清洗和转换,确保数据的准确性和一致性。
  6. 报表设计与开发:根据需求设计报表模板,配置报表工具以自动化生成各类订单报表。
  7. 测试与部署:进行全面的测试,确保集成后的系统稳定可靠。测试完成后,进行部署并上线。
  8. 维护与优化:集成后需要定期维护和优化,及时解决出现的问题,并根据业务需求进行调整。

这些步骤是实现报表工具与订单管理系统集成的关键环节,每一步都必须严格遵循,以确保最终系统的稳定性和可靠性。

问题2:如何确保数据在集成过程中的准确性和一致性?

数据的准确性和一致性是集成过程中的关键因素,确保数据的准确性和一致性可以从以下几方面入手:

  1. 数据校验:在数据导入报表工具之前,进行严格的数据校验,检查数据的完整性和正确性。设置校验规则,自动筛查并修正错误数据。
  2. 数据清洗:通过数据清洗工具,清除重复数据、错误数据和不完整数据。确保导入的数据是干净和可用的。
  3. 数据转换:根据报表工具的需求,对数据进行转换,确保数据格式一致。例如,将日期格式统一转换为标准格式,数值类型进行标准化处理。
  4. 实时更新:通过设置数据同步机制,确保订单数据在报表工具中实时更新,避免数据滞后引起的不一致。
  5. 日志记录与监控:设置详细的数据导入日志和实时监控,及时发现和解决数据问题。通过报警机制,快速响应数据异常。
  6. 测试与验证:在集成过程中,进行多次测试和验证,确保数据在每个环节都是准确和一致的。通过测试数据和实际数据的对比,确认集成效果。

这些措施可以有效地保证数据在集成过程中的准确性和一致性,避免因数据问题造成的业务决策失误。

问题3:选择报表工具时需要考虑哪些关键因素?

在选择报表工具时,以下关键因素需要重点考虑:

  1. 兼容性与集成能力:报表工具必须能够兼容现有的订单管理系统,并且具备强大的数据集成能力。例如,FineReport支持多种数据源,易于与各种订单管理系统集成。
  2. 性能与稳定性:报表工具需要具备高性能和高稳定性,能够处理大规模的数据集,并在高并发访问时保持稳定。
  3. 易用性:报表工具的操作界面应该简洁友好,易于上手,能够减少学习成本和使用难度。
  4. 定制化能力:报表工具应该具备强大的定制化能力,能够根据具体需求设计各种复杂的报表。
  5. 安全性:数据安全是选择报表工具的重要考虑因素。报表工具需要具备完善的权限管理和数据保护机制,确保数据安全。
  6. 支持与服务:选择有良好技术支持和服务的报表工具供应商,能够在使用过程中提供及时的帮助和解决方案。

综合这些因素,帆软的FineReport在市场上有着良好的口碑和广泛的应用,可以作为首选报表工具进行试用: FineReport免费下载试用

问题4:如何实现报表的自动化生成和定时发送?

实现报表的自动化生成和定时发送,可以通过以下步骤:

  1. 配置报表模板:在报表工具中设计并配置报表模板,设置好数据源、报表格式和展示内容。
  2. 定时任务设置:通过报表工具的定时任务功能,设置报表生成的时间和频率。例如,可以设置每天凌晨自动生成前一天的订单报表。
  3. 自动生成报表:报表工具根据预设的定时任务,自动从订单管理系统获取最新数据,生成报表并保存。
  4. 定时发送:配置报表工具的邮件发送功能,设置报表接收者的邮箱地址和发送时间。报表生成后,系统会自动将报表以附件形式发送给指定的接收者。
  5. 日志与监控:开启日志记录和监控功能,跟踪报表生成和发送的全过程,确保每次任务顺利完成。如果出现问题,及时报警并处理。

通过这些步骤,可以实现报表的自动化生成和定时发送,提高工作效率,确保重要数据及时送达相关人员。

问题5:在集成过程中,如何处理数据量大和复杂度高的问题?

在集成过程中,面对数据量大和复杂度高的问题,可以采用以下方法:

  1. 分批处理:将大数据量分批处理,减少单次导入的数据量,降低系统压力。通过设置合理的数据批次大小,确保数据处理的效率和稳定性。
  2. 优化数据库性能:对订单管理系统的数据库进行优化,如建立索引、优化查询语句、分区存储等,提高数据读取和写入的效率。
  3. 使用缓存:在数据集成过程中,使用缓存机制,将频繁访问的数据缓存到内存中,减少数据库的访问次数,提高数据处理速度。
  4. 并行处理:采用多线程或分布式处理技术,将数据处理任务分解为多个并行任务,提高处理效率。
  5. 数据清洗与预处理:在数据导入之前,进行数据清洗和预处理,减少数据冗余和不必要的复杂度,确保数据的质量和一致性。
  6. 优化报表工具性能:选择性能优越的报表工具,如FineReport,确保报表生成和数据处理的效率。FineReport在处理大数据量和复杂报表方面有着优秀的表现,可以下载试用: FineReport免费下载试用

通过这些方法,可以有效应对数据量大和复杂度高的问题,保证集成过程的顺利进行和系统的稳定运行。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

若想了解关于FineReport的详细信息,您可以访问下方链接,或点击组件,快速获得免费的FineReport试用、同行业报表建设标杆案例学习参考,以及帆软为您企业量身定制的企业报表管理中心建设建议。

更多企业级报表工具介绍:www.finereport.com

帆软企业级报表工具FineReport
免费下载!

免费下载

帆软全行业业务报表
Demo免费体验!

Demo体验
帆软企业数字化建设产品推荐
报表开发平台免费试用
自助式BI分析免费试用
数据可视化大屏免费试用
数据集成平台免费试用